The Apostle Islands National Lakeshore in Wisconsin offers a variety of stunning lakes and rivers for kayaking. The state offers countless options for both easy and challenging adventures, with top picks including kayaking to the Sand Island Sea Caves, hiking to Big and Little Manitou Falls in Pattison State Park, and kayaking the Wisconsin River in the Dells.

Madison’s lakes offer plenty of paddling opportunities, with canoes, kayaks, and stand-up paddleboards available for rent at UW-Madisons Memorial Union and Madison Boats. The WI river is not crowded once you are away from Madison, with other canoes and boaters present.
